Bogus Basin Mountain Recreation Area is a renowned nonprofit mountain resort located in the Boise National Forest, Idaho. As the largest nonprofit Mountain Recreation Area in the nation, Bogus Basin is dedicated to providing accessible and affordable outdoor recreation, education, and community programming throughout the year. This mission-driven organization reinvests every dollar earned back into the mountain and its overall community, reflecting its commitment to kindness, respect, professionalism, and fun. Job Duties

  • Maintain a neat and clean condition of all assigned areas including trash removal, sweeping, mopping, vacuuming, and window cleaning
  • Clean and restock bathrooms and report any maintenance issues as needed
  • Organize and maintain cleanliness in lodge common areas
  • Promote safety by following safe practices and reporting unsafe conditions
  • Assist guests with questions or concerns and direct them to supervisors or managers
  • Perform other related tasks as necessary
